// Returns the contents of the effective policy for specified policy type and
// account. The effective policy is the aggregation of any policies of the
// specified type that the account inherits, plus any policy of that type that is
// directly attached to the account.
//
// This operation applies only to policy types other than service control policies
// (SCPs).
//
// For more information about policy inheritance, see [Understanding management policy inheritance] in the Organizations User
// Guide.
//
// This operation can be called from any account in the organization.
